Akinyode Dele's goal with 1:25 left in the game was the
difference in the Knights' 2-1 road win over Molloy College on
Saturday. Danny Stoker assisted on the goal and added another one
to enable QC to even their ECC record at 2-2-1.
The Knights held Molloy without a shot over the first 45 minutes
while taking six of their own but went to the intermission tied at
0-0. Tyler Iocco and Kevin Vazquez came close to changing that,
with each htting a goal post in the first half.
Stoker finally got QC on the board, placing a free kick in the
lower right hand side of the net with 4:57 expired in the second
half for his seventh of the season. Molloy drew even at the 60:22
mark when another free kick resulted in a goal by Jovani Ramos.
With less than two minutes remaining in regualtion, Stoker
directed a cross from the right corner towards the net that found
Dele, who headed the ball past Molloy goalkeeper Michael Hunter for
the game winning goal.
